Alien TV (2020)

Also Known As: Alien TV
IMDB
6.56
Release Date
2020
End Date
2021
Overview:
Alien reporters Ixbee, Pixbee and Squee travel to a lovely but odd planet called Earth, where they attempt to make sense of humans and their hobbies.
Comments
The comment field is only for members. Login, Register